The Unseen World: How Technology Transforms Wildlife Documentaries

For decades, wildlife documentaries have served as windows into nature’s most remote corners, but recent technological advancements have fundamentally transformed how we perceive the natural world. Where traditional filmmaking once relied on patient observation and occasional luck, modern documentarians now employ cutting-edge tools that reveal previously invisible dimensions of animal behavior and ecological systems.

High-definition cameras with unprecedented zoom capabilities allow viewers to witness intimate moments from safe distances, while drone technology provides breathtaking aerial perspectives of migrations and habitats. Perhaps most revolutionary has been the development of camera traps and remote sensors that operate continuously, capturing behaviors that elude human observers. These devices have documented everything from rare snow leopard sightings in the Himalayas to the complex social structures of forest elephants in Central Africa.

Underwater cinematography has undergone its own revolution with submersible cameras that can withstand extreme pressures and temperatures, revealing deep-sea ecosystems that were once purely speculative. Simultaneously, thermal imaging and night-vision equipment have illuminated the nocturnal world, showing how predators hunt and prey evade under cover of darkness.

Yet this technological prowess comes with profound responsibility. Documentarians must balance their pursuit of spectacular footage with minimal disruption to natural behaviors. The most respected filmmakers adhere to strict ethical guidelines, using technology not to manipulate nature but to observe it more authentically. As climate change accelerates habitat loss, these documentaries serve as both educational tools and urgent calls to action, reminding global audiences that preserving biodiversity is not merely an aesthetic concern but an existential necessity.

The future promises even more immersive experiences through virtual reality and interactive platforms, potentially creating deeper emotional connections between viewers and the natural world. However, the core mission remains unchanged: to foster understanding and inspire conservation through truthful, compelling storytelling about Earth’s magnificent but fragile ecosystems.


💡 Language Highlights

  1. Complex sentence structure: ‘Where traditional filmmaking once relied on patient observation and occasional luck, modern documentarians now employ cutting-edge tools that reveal previously invisible dimensions of animal behavior and ecological systems.’ - This is a complex sentence with a dependent clause beginning with ‘Where’ that contrasts past and present approaches, followed by an independent clause containing a relative clause (‘that reveal…’).
  2. Idiom: ‘windows into’ - This idiom means providing insight or access to something otherwise inaccessible, used here to describe how documentaries help viewers understand remote natural environments.
  3. Complex sentence structure: ‘As climate change accelerates habitat loss, these documentaries serve as both educational tools and urgent calls to action, reminding global audiences that preserving biodiversity is not merely an aesthetic concern but an existential necessity.’ - This sentence begins with a dependent clause (‘As climate change…’), followed by an independent clause with parallel structure (‘both…and…’), and concludes with a participial phrase (‘reminding…’) containing a noun clause (‘that preserving…’).
